如何将博途作为opc服务器
① 博途软件中smart200PLC怎样配置OPC
1、博图软件不能对Smart200系列PLC编程。
2、Smart200系列PLC的OPC软件请去西门子官网下载PC ACCESS Smart软件,请注意别下错了,PC ACCESS是200系列的OPC软件,PC ACCESS Smart才是Smart200系列的OPC软件。
② 组态王中如何定义opc服务器
1、首先要知道什么叫OPC,OPC是一个运行于基于PC操作系统的软件,所以做OPC是不现实的,建议使用SIMATIC NET(net pc6.x)或者其他第三方OPC软件。
2、现在版本的组态王针对西门子300系列的驱动已经可以使用了,如果不是使用CP5611等等专门的通讯卡,建议使用组态王本身的驱动来采集数据。
3、如果使用CP5611或者以太网等等来和西门子PLC通讯,建议用NET PC来做OPC,以太网方式的话还可以采用Kepware等OPC均可。
③ opc服务器是什么是硬件还是软件啊!!麻烦知道的内行帮忙解释解释~~
opc既不是硬件也不是软件。OPC是一种通讯规范,OPC基金会组织规定的一套规范,按照这个规范去把程序写出来,包括一个OPC服务器程序和一个OPC客户端程序,只要是按规范写的,不管是谁写的,就能保证OPC服务器能被OPC客户端访问。
opc服务器向下可以读取设备的数据,比如PLC、DCS等等,但这部分OPC规范是不管的,只要厂家用任意接口任意方法把设备数据读到就OK,然后OPC服务器程序把这些读到的数据按规范要求开放在网络上,其他任意OPC客户端程序,可以远程浏览这些数据,并选择读取这些数据中需要的。
(3)如何将博途作为opc服务器扩展阅读
OPC的工作原理
OPC以OLE/COM机制作为应用程序的通信标准,而OLE/COM是一种客户端/服务器模式,具有语言无关性、代码重用性、易于集成性等优点。
OPC服务器中的代码确定了服务器所存取的设备和数据、数据项的命名规则和服务器存取数据的细节,不管现场设备以何种形式存在,客户都以统一的方式去访问,从而保证软件对客户的透明性,使得用户完全从低层的开发中脱离出来。
客户应用程序仅须使用标准接口和服务器通信,而并不需要知道底层的实现细节。通过OPC服务器,OPC客户既可以直接读写物理VO设备的数据,也可操作SCADA,DCS等系统的端口变量(只要该系统提供OPC服务)。
④ 博途如何限制一个OPC访问
打开项目文件,选中PLC后,右击选择"属性”,在属性窗口中找到"防护与安全,设置该PLC的防护等级。
首先,我们打开项目文件,选中PLC后,右击选择"属性”,在属性窗口中找到"防护与安全",可以看到当前PLC的防护等级;在该界面中,可以设置该PLC的防护等级,一共分为4种:完全访问权限、读访问权限、HMI访问权限和不能访问(完全保护)默认为该设置,无密码保护,允许完全访问;⒉.读访问权限没有输入密码的情况下,只允许进行只读访问,无法更改CPU上的任何数据,也无法装载任何块或组态。选择这个保护等级需要指定“完全访问权限(无任何保护)的密码:"密码1"。如果需要写访问,则需要输入密码1。